UPMC Corporate Services is hiring a Patient Services Representative to support patient registration in the Emergency Department at UPMC Presbyterian Hosptial.
 
Status: Full-time, 36 hours/weekly
Shift: 7:00pm-7:30am
Days: Varied days, weekends and holidays.
 
We are seeking candidates with a strong customer service background and a desire to be empowered to ensure a positive experience during a patient's visit to a UPMC Hospital.

Responsibilities:
 
  • Responsible for reconciliation and maintenance of First Net Emergency Department Tracking Board and Hospital ADT system.
  • Accountable for accurate registration into hospital ADT and/or clinical system during system downtime with monitoring and reconciliation of every patient for accuracy.Central Resource for all ADT registration and problem resolution during evenings, weekends and holidays.
  • Confirms insurance eligibility, accountable for third party reimbursement and coordination of benefits to support a seamless billing process.
  • Counsels patients regarding insurance coverage and expected financial liability. Collects and records patient payments including co-payments, co-insurance, and deductibles on the day of service.
  • Provides a warm greeting for all patients. Support and contribute to UPMC core values and guiding principles of Your Care. Our Commitment and abide by all UPMC departmental policies, procedures and goals in the process of performing all job responsibilities. Incorporates acts of dignity and respect in daily interactions.
  • Proper patient identification to start clinical record (utilizing biometrics if applicable)
  • Facilitator of financial gatekeeping with clinical partners.
  • Accountable for maintaining a close working relationship with clinical partners to assure continual open communication with pertinent information obtained such as any alias name changes, information blocks to prevent release of information, and behavioral health insurance payors to assure timely data integrity of accounts.
  • Obtains or updates necessary demographic and insurance related information.
  • Works independently to perform a timely patient interview and registration for services at the bed side.
  • Generates and completes all applicable forms and necessary communications. Obtains applicable signature for consent to treat and financial responsibility, along with signatures on any required forms, while following all HIPAA rules and regulations and maintaining patient confidentiality.
  • Ability to remain calm and professional when faced with stressful situations, while simultaneously prioritizing all work activities.
  • Anticipates and responds to inquiries from patients, visitors, hospital personnel, government agencies, etc. under all conditions and circumstances.

Security Alert

We are aware of scams targeting UPMC and other large companies that involve individuals posing as employees to illegitimately conduct interviews and extend false employment offers and payments to gain access to candidates' personal information. Please note that UPMC will not communicate with candidates through third-party email services like Gmail or Yahoo. While some interviews may take place via a video conferencing service, UPMC Talent Acquisition will not conduct interviews via Skype or Google Hangouts. UPMC will never ask for or disburse funds during the recruitment process. If you are hired into a role with a sign-on bonus or similar incentive, funds will be paid to you by UPMC after your start date.
